Nigeria to Libya by Air freight

The quickest way to get from Nigeria to Libya by plane will take about 12h 50m and departs from Mallam Aminu International Airport (KAN) and arrives into Benina International Airport (BEN). There are flights departing every 4-6 weeks on this route. EgyptAir is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with flights departing every 4-6 weeks.

Nigeria to Libya by Container ship

The quickest way to get from Nigeria to Libya by ship will take about 19 days 19h and departs from Tincan (NGTIN) and arrives into Bingazi (LYBEN). There are vessels departing every 2-4 weeks on this route. MSC is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with vessels departing every 2-4 weeks.

Nigeria to Libya by Road

It is also possible to transport goods by road from Nigeria to Libya. The total distance is around 3,967 km and will usually takes around 3 days 7h by road. Note: This time estimate is based on typical traffic conditions and does not take into consideration delays or congestion.
